RTÉ Board Member Daire Hickey Resigns Amidst Ongoing ControversiesBusinessman Daire Hickey is stepping down from his role on the board of Irish broadcaster RTÉ after four years. His resignation comes during a period of significant scrutiny for the organization, particularly surrounding payments made to popular broadcaster Ryan Tubridy. Hickey's tenure coincided with a controversy involving payments to Tubridy linked to a deal with Renault Ireland, leading to a full investigation by Grant Thornton. While the exact details of the payments remain under investigation, they have raised serious questions about financial transparency and governance at RTÉ.
